I WONDER - What Are The Phases Of The Moon?

The video explains how the moon's phases depend on sunlight reflection. It covers the eight phases of the lunar month: new moon, waxing crescent, first quarter, waxing gibbous, full moon, waning gibbous, third quarter, and waning crescent. The cycle repeats every 29.5 days, with each phase having distinct characteristics.
